DULUTH, Minn. – Freshman Justin Meers (St. Charles, Mo.) has been named this week's Northern Collegiate Hockey Association (NCHA) Men's Offensive Player of the Week following a strong performance against MSOE.
It is the fourth time this season that a Thunder student-athlete has earned player of the week honors, the second that the award has gone to an offensive player. It is the first time in his career that Meers had taken home the award.
Trine went 1-0-1 at MSOE this past weekend, securing the program's first berth in the Harris Cup Playoffs. Meers netted crucial goals in both games to lead the team to the record.
On Friday, Meers came up with the Thunder's lone goal of the contest. That goal brought the team back from a 1-0 deficit to tie the game at one. The 1-1 score would become the final as the teams stalemated each other through the rest of the game.
Then on Saturday, Meers finished the contest with two goals. The first started off the scoring in the contest coming in the tenth minute of the contest. The second helped to ice the game giving the team a 3-1 lead at the halfway point of the third period.
The Thunder will finish off the regular season with a pair of contests against nationally-ranked Adrian College. The home series will determine the final seed of both teams as they head into the first round of the Harris Cup Playoffs.
